yeah disco the rear. heck take it off u cant tell it on the road w/ the front one still one. i run with out any sway bars all the time. ive heard that taking the front off really doesnt help the KJ though.

I've had my rear sway bar removed for about 6 months now, no issues. Up front the sway bar doesn't limit travel hardly at all.
